§ 44-812 — Prohibition of confinement of members of the state

Oklahoma·Title 44 Militia
military forces with enemy prisoners and certain others. ARTICLE 12. Prohibition of confinement of members of the state military forces with enemy prisoners and certain others. No member of the state military forces shall be placed in confinement in immediate association with: 1. Enemy prisoners; or 2. Other individuals: a. who are detained under the law of war and are foreign nationals, and b. who are not members of the armed forces.

Legislative History

Added by Laws 2019, c. 408, § 18, eff. Oct. 1, 2019.
